Italy Smart Antenna Market Overview:

The Italy smart antenna market size reached USD 49.60 Million in 2024.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 74.80 Million by 2033,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 4.20% during 2025-2033. The expansion of 5G networks, increasing internet users, and the rapid deployment of smart infrastructure and public Wi-Fi, is driving the demand for smart antennas to enhance connectivity, optimize bandwidth, and support high-speed, high-capacity wireless communication across urban and rural areas.

Italy Smart Antenna Market Trends:

Expansion of Fifth Generation (5G) Networks

Italy’s active expansion of its 5G infrastructure is a major factor driving the demand for advanced smart antennas. 5G networks operate on both low and high-frequency spectrums including millimeter-wave (mmWave) bands, which offer extremely high data transfer speeds but are prone to signal degradation over short distances and physical obstructions. Smart antennas direct the signal in precise beams towards specific users or devices, improving signal strength and quality. In dense urban environments, where obstacles like buildings may block high-frequency signals, smart antennas optimize signal direction to ensure better connectivity. Moreover, 5G networks aim to handle higher numbers of connected devices, ranging from smartphones to the Internet of Things (IoT) systems, requiring enhanced capacity. As per the 5G Observatory, the Italian 5G private network market could be worth €200 million by 2025.

Rising Number of Internet Users

The number of internet users in Italy was 51.56 million at the beginning of 2024, as per the Ecommerce Italia. The increasing number of internet users in Italy is impelling the market growth. There is a rise in the focus on better network capacity, coverage, and speed. Traditional communication infrastructure can struggle to handle high load efficiently. Smart antennas enhance the performance of wireless networks by optimizing bandwidth use. They allow for more efficient use of available bandwidth, ensuring that even with a growing number of users, data transmission remains fast and reliable. They can handle high-density environments more effectively while ensuring stable connections for more users simultaneously. There is a rise in the demand for consistent and high-quality connectivity across all regions of Italy, including rural and remote areas. Furthermore, the increasing utilization of smart devices is strengthening the market growth in the country.

Expansion of Smart Infrastructure and Public Wi-Fi Networks

The rapid expansion of smart infrastructure and public Wi-Fi networks is a key driver of the Italy smart antenna market, as cities invest in advanced digital services, surveillance systems, and smart transportation. The demand for reliable wireless connectivity is increasing, necessitating efficient antenna solutions to optimize signal strength, enhance network performance, and support seamless communication in densely populated urban areas. The deployment of public Wi-Fi networks in commercial centers, transportation hubs, and public spaces requires high-performance smart antennas capable of managing multiple simultaneous connections without interference. In line with this trend, INWIT, Italy’s largest tower company, acquired a 51% stake in Boldyn Networks Smart City Roma in 2024, strengthening its role in Italy’s digital infrastructure development. The project involves deploying 2,200 small cells, 850 public Wi-Fi access points, 1,800 IoT sensors, 2,000 5G CCTV cameras, and distributed antenna systems (DAS) across Rome, aligning with INWIT’s 2024-2026 business plan to support telecom operators in smart city initiatives. Such large-scale investments accelerate the adoption of smart antennas, improving network stability, optimizing bandwidth efficiency, and facilitating Italy’s transition toward a digitally integrated society. The continued expansion of smart city projects is expected to drive sustained demand for advanced smart antenna solutions.

Italy Smart Antenna Market News:

  • In March 2024, Thales Alenia Space, a collaboration between Thales and Leonardo, has entered into an agreement with the Italian space agency (ASI) to create the communications subsystem for the groundbreaking International Mars Ice Mapper (I-MIM) mission. Thales Alenia Space will handle the multi-user communications system for the mission and will also create the advanced large deployable reflector (LDR) antenna, allowing the orbiter to set up high-data-rate communications with ground stations in both Ka-band and X-band.
  • In January 2024, MTA revealed the purchase of a business segment from Calearo Antenne. Additionally, Calearo Antenne, located in Isola Vicentina near Vicenza (Italy), creates and produces cutting-edge communication technologies. The MTA Group acquired a business unit that encompasses the operations of its Italian facility in Isola Vicentina, which includes assets, patents, licenses, and expertise used to manufacture different kinds of antennas such as 5G cellular, Wi-Fi, WB, AM/FM, DAB, SDARS, GNSS, V2X, among others.
